Description

A kind of cold-storage insulation double-purpose is asked for locker
Technical field
The utility model relates to logistics distribution field, particularly relates to a kind of cold-storage insulation double-purpose and to ask for locker.
Background technology
Along with the fast development of ecommerce, net purchase transaction is more and more general, in the mode that client and delivery person join face-to-face, the inconveniences such as delivery period is uncertain, the necessary spot delivery of both sides, there is logistics distribution terminal locker in some communities successively.But current locker only has the function of storing, for the fast development of current fresh food and carryout, can not meet personalized demand.
Utility model content
For above-mentioned weak point of the prior art, the utility model provides a kind of cold-storage insulation double-purpose and to ask for locker, it can carry out cold-storage insulation to the fresh product after disengaging cold chain locomotive, and the service of fresh product of asking at any time for 24 hours can be provided for customer, avoid dispensing person and be dispensed directly into process in customer's hand, thus solve a fresh product delivery difficult problem for logistics distribution chain end, meet the growth requirement of the novel logistics system of low energy consumption.Limit the development of fresh food and take-away.
The purpose of this utility model is achieved through the following technical solutions:
The utility model embodiment provides a kind of cold-storage insulation double-purpose to ask for locker, comprising: locker cabinet, identity recognition device, fridge equipment and some accumulation of heat boxes; Wherein,
Described locker cabinet is provided with multiple storing bin, and the door of each storing bin is equipped with electronic lock;
Described identity recognition device is located on described locker cabinet, and this identity recognition device comprises: touch-screen, short message transceiving module, micro controller system, memory cell, electronic lock driving circuit and supply unit; Wherein, described touch-screen, short message transceiving module, memory cell and electronic lock driving circuit are all electrically connected with micro controller system, and described electronic lock driving circuit is electrically connected with the electronic lock of described each storing bin door respectively, can control the open and close of each electronic lock; Described supply unit is electrically connected with touch-screen, micro controller system, short message transceiving module, memory cell and electronic lock driving circuit respectively;
Multiple storing bins of described locker cabinet are divided into soak zones and cool storage area, are equipped with pallet in each storing bin of described soak zones, described pallet are equipped with described accumulation of heat box;
The locker cabinet side at each storing bin place of described cool storage area is provided with a circulating cold air pipe, and described fridge equipment is located at the side top of described locker cabinet, and the air outlet of this fridge equipment is communicated with described circulating cold air pipe; On described circulating cold air pipe, the position of each storing bin of corresponding described cool storage area offers at least one eye of wind; The each storing bin corresponding with described circulating cold air pipe position offers at least one breather port be communicated with the eye of wind of circulating cold air pipe respectively;
The bottom of described locker cabinet is provided with return flume.
The beneficial effects of the utility model are: because this locker is provided with soak zones and cool storage area at locker cabinet, are equipped with accumulation of heat box in each storing bin of soak zones, can to the take-away product insulation of depositing.And each storing bin of cool storage area to coordinate with circulating cold air pipe by the fridge equipment arranged and supplies cold air, the fresh product deposited can be refrigerated, thus effectively can ensure quality and the quality of fresh product in each storing bin in this region.In addition, this cold-storage insulation formula locker of asking for is provided with identity recognition device 3, picking people needs to obtain identifying code note, and by the correct input validation code of touch-screen 32, just can open the electronic lock of the storing bin 2 corresponding to order number of picking people, thus the fresh product that just can obtain in this storing bin 2, therefore this cold-storage insulation formula locker of asking for safely for customer provides the service of fresh product of asking at any time for 24 hours, can solve the fresh product of logistics distribution chain end and a dispensing difficult problem for carryout.

Detailed description of the invention
Below in conjunction with the accompanying drawing in the utility model embodiment, be clearly and completely described the technical scheme in the utility model embodiment, obviously, described embodiment is only the utility model part embodiment, instead of whole embodiments.Based on embodiment of the present utility model, those of ordinary skill in the art, not making the every other embodiment obtained under creative work prerequisite, belong to protection domain of the present utility model.
Figure 1 shows that a kind of cold-storage insulation double-purpose that the utility model embodiment provides is asked for locker, this locker has insulation and cold storage function, the order takeaway interim reception of food of person easy to use is deposited, locker of this cold-storage insulation formula can being asked for is placed on the doorway of each residential quarters, thus provides comparatively convenience for customer's picking.This locker comprises: locker cabinet 1, identity recognition device 3, fridge equipment 4 and some accumulation of heat boxes 9; Wherein,
Locker cabinet 1 is provided with multiple storing bin 2, and the door of each storing bin 2 is equipped with electronic lock;
Identity recognition device 3 is located on locker cabinet 1, and this identity recognition device 3 comprises: touch-screen 31, short message transceiving module, micro controller system, memory cell, electronic lock driving circuit and supply unit; Wherein, touch-screen 31, short message transceiving module, memory cell and electronic lock driving circuit are all electrically connected with micro controller system, and electronic lock driving circuit is electrically connected with the electronic lock of each storing bin 2 door respectively, can control the open and close of each electronic lock; Supply unit is electrically connected with touch-screen 31, micro controller system, short message transceiving module, memory cell and electronic lock driving circuit respectively;
Multiple storing bins 2 of locker cabinet 1 are divided into soak zones and cool storage area, be equipped with pallet 10, pallet 10 be equipped with accumulation of heat box 9 in each storing bin 2 of soak zones, can ensure the insulation to the take-away product deposited.Preferably, soak zones can be located at the left side of this locker cabinet 1, cool storage area be located at the right side of this locker cabinet 1.
Locker cabinet 1 side at each storing bin 2 place of cool storage area is provided with a circulating cold air pipe 6, and fridge equipment 4 is located at the side top of locker cabinet 1, and the air outlet of this fridge equipment 4 is communicated with circulating cold air pipe 6; On circulating cold air pipe 6, the position of each storing bin 2 of corresponding cool storage area offers at least one eye of wind 61; The each storing bin 2 corresponding with circulating cold air pipe 6 position offers respectively the breather port that at least one is communicated with the eye of wind 61 of circulating cold air pipe 6; By the cooperation of breather port on fridge equipment 4, circulating cold air pipe 6 and each storing bin 2, cold air can be inputted to each storing bin 2 of cool storage area, make each storing bin 2 become reefer chamber.As long as fridge equipment 4 continuous operations, just there is circulating of cold air all the time between each storing bin 2 of so cool storage area, fresh product also will be in cold-storage insulation state always, thus effectively can ensure quality and the quality of fresh product.
The bottom of locker cabinet 1 is provided with return flume 7, is convenient to receive the condensate water that soak zones and cool storage area formed and discharges.
In above-mentioned locker, the air outlet of fridge equipment 4 is equipped with fan 5, the air outlet position of each fan 5 is corresponding with the admission port of circulating cold air pipe 6.
In above-mentioned locker, rear wall and the door of each storing bin 2 of locker cabinet 1 are equipped with heat-insulation layer.Promote insulation or the cold storage effect of each storing bin 2.
In above-mentioned locker, identity recognition device 3 is located at the middle part in locker cabinet 1 front.Be convenient to user's operation.
In above-mentioned locker, the cool storage area side of locker cabinet 1 is provided with two cold air conveying chambers 8, and circulating cold air pipe 6 is located in cold air conveying chamber 8, and cold air conveying chamber 8 can ensure in cold air course of conveying further, the loss of cold.
In above-mentioned locker, touch-screen 31 is located at the surface of identity recognition device 3, is in the front surface of locker cabinet 1; The inside of locker cabinet 1 is all located at by the micro controller system of identity recognition device 3, short message transceiving module, memory cell, electronic lock driving circuit and supply unit.

Embodiment one
As depicted in figs. 1 and 2, a kind of cold-storage insulation double-purpose is asked for locker, and its concrete structure can comprise: locker cabinet 1, identity recognition device 3, fridge equipment 4 attemperator 9; Identity recognition device 3 is located on locker cabinet 1; Locker cabinet 1 is provided with multiple storing bin 2; The door of each storing bin 2 is equipped with electronic lock; Identity recognition device 3 comprises touch-screen 31, short message transceiving module, micro controller system, memory cell, electronic lock driving circuit and power circuit; Touch-screen 31, short message transceiving module, memory cell and electronic lock driving circuit are all electrically connected with micro controller system, and electronic lock driving circuit is electrically connected with electronic lock; Power circuit is electrically connected with touch-screen 31, micro controller system, short message transceiving module, memory cell and electronic lock driving circuit respectively;
The right side of locker cabinet 1 is provided with a circulating cold air pipe 6; Fridge equipment 4 is located at the right hand top of locker cabinet 1, and the air outlet of fridge equipment 4 is communicated with circulating cold air pipe 6; On circulating cold air pipe 6, the position of each storing bin 2 in corresponding right side offers at least one eye of wind 61; The each storing bin 2 in right side being positioned at circulating cold air pipe 6 side offers at least one breather port be communicated with the eye of wind 61 of circulating cold air pipe 6 respectively; At least one breather port is offered between each storing bin 2; The bottom of locker cabinet 1 is provided with return flume 7.
Be provided with baffle plate 10 in each storing bin 2 in the left side of locker cabinet 1, be placed with accumulation of heat box 9 above, for the insulation of carryout, can recycle.
Wherein, this cold-storage insulation formula locker of asking for can comprise following embodiment:
(1) touch-screen 31, micro controller system, short message transceiving module, memory cell and electronic lock all can adopt the electronic equipment obtained by commercial means of the prior art.
(2) electronic lock driving circuit can adopt in prior art take PLC as the electronic lock driving circuit of core, due to the electronic circuit of to take PLC as the electronic lock driving circuit of core be comparative maturity in prior art, therefore repeats no more in the application.
(3) power circuit can adopt dry storage battery of the prior art, lithium cell powers, and the utility network that also directly can access 220V is powered.
(4) air outlet on the right side of fridge equipment 4 is provided with a fan 5, and the air outlet of fan 5 is just to the admission port of circulating cold air pipe 6, this not only can make the cold air prepared by fridge equipment 4 farthest be sent in circulating cold air pipe 6, and the cold air improved prepared by fridge equipment 4 enters into the speed of circulating cold air pipe 6.
(5) be all provided with baffle plate 10 in the storehouse of the storing bin 2 on the left of, baffle plate 10 be placed with accumulation of heat box 9, can recycle.
(6) rear wall of each storing bin 2 and door are equipped with heat-insulation layer; This heat-insulation layer can adopt heat preserving method conventional in prior art, such as: rear wall and the door of each storing bin 2 cover one deck phenol formaldehyde foam.This heat-insulation layer significantly can reduce the loss of cold air, thus extends the cold preservation time of fresh product, reduces the replacement cycle of cold-storage insulation agent.
(7) identity recognition device 3 is located at the middle part of locker cabinet 1, this not only can facilitate customer to operate, also storing bin 2 number of identity recognition device 3 both sides can be made identical, thus make the storing bin 2 of the circulating cold air pipe 6 of both sides to identical number carry out cold-storage insulation, reduce the problem that cold air difference in distribution is excessive.
(8) right side of locker cabinet 1 is respectively provided with a cold air conveying chamber 8; Circulating cold air pipe 6 is located in cold air conveying chamber 8; This cold air not only effectively reducing circulating cold air pipe 6 runs off to the outside of locker cabinet 1, and can reduce the destruction of external environment to circulating cold air pipe 6, improves the safety of circulating cold air pipe 6, extends service life.
(9) touch-screen 31 is located at the surface of locker cabinet 1; The inside of locker cabinet 1 is all located at by micro controller system, short message transceiving module, memory cell, electronic lock driving circuit and power circuit.
(10) fridge equipment 4 can adopt fridge equipment of the prior art, such as: can adopt the fridge equipment used in refrigerator or air-conditioning.Because these fridge equipments belong to the category of prior art, repeat no more herein.
(11) the sorting personnel of logistics can input order odd numbers corresponding to each storing bin 2 and corresponding picking people cell-phone number by touch-screen 32, also the note order odd numbers corresponding to each storing bin 2 and corresponding picking people cell-phone number can being compiled predetermined format issues the identity recognition device 3 giving this cold-storage insulation formula to ask for locker, and the micro controller system of this identity recognition device 3 can receive the note of the predetermined format that picking people cell-phone number sends by short message transceiving module, and the order odd numbers extracted corresponding to each storing bin 2 and corresponding picking people cell-phone number, restore in memory cell.
Further, this cold-storage insulation formula locker of asking for can adopt following flow process to realize asking for: sorting personnel can by the fresh product of each order or outer second product put into the storing bin 2 of the left and right sides respectively, and order odd numbers corresponding to each storing bin 2 and corresponding picking people cell-phone number can be inputted by touch-screen 32.Order odd numbers corresponding to each storing bin 2 and corresponding picking people cell-phone number are saved in memory cell by micro controller system.When picking people picking, input order number by touch-screen 32; The order number that picking people inputs by micro controller system and the order number that memory cell is stored up contrast, when finding the order number of coupling, micro controller system stochastic generation identifying code associated with this order number, and be saved in memory cell, control short message transceiving module simultaneously and send this identifying code with the form of note to the picking people cell-phone number corresponding to this order number; Picking people, after receiving the note comprising this identifying code, inputs the identifying code in note by touch-screen 32; The identifying code associated with this order number that the identifying code that picking people inputs stores up with memory cell by micro controller system contrasts, if both comparative results are identical, then the electronic lock of the storing bin 2 corresponding with this order number opened by Single-chip Controlling electronic lock driving circuit, thus customer just can obtain fresh product in this storing bin 2 or carryout.Obviously, this cold-storage insulation formula locker of asking for can be the service that customer provides ask at any time for 24 hours safely and reliably, solves a dispensing difficult problem for fresh product or carryout logistics distribution chain end.
